Hey, This is Goofyninja101. I have one question. If someone buys a product and the seller puts the money in there bank, will paypal take money out of the bank if they chargeback?

No, unless you manually add funds from your bank to zero out the PayPal balance. Otherwise, PayPal will put your account in the negative or deduct/hold and money received into your PayPal balance, tack on what you owe when you make a purchase.
